RATE SCHEDULE PLNG-2 (Continued)
ARTICLE IX
Force Majeure
9.1 "Force Majeure" means any event or condition, whether
affecting Pan National, TLC or any other person, which has
prevented or may reasonably be expected to prevent either party
hereto from performing any obligation hereunder, in whole or in
part, if such event or condition is beyond the reasonable or
prudent control, forecasting or planning, and not the result of
willful or negligent action or a lack of reasonable diligence,
of the party hereto (the "Non-Performing Party") relying
thereon as justification for not performing any such
obligation. The foregoing provisions shall not be construed to
require that the Non-Performing Party observe a higher standard
of conduct than that required by the usual and customary
standards of the industry, as a condition to claiming the
existence of Force Majeure. Such events or conditions shall
include but shall not be limited to circumstances of the
following kind:
(a) (i) an act of God or government, epidemic,
landslide, lightning, earthquake, fire, explosion,
accident, storm, flood or similar occurrence, an act of the
public enemy, war, blockade, insurrection, riot, civil
disturbance or similar occurrence, or (ii) a strike,
lockout, or similar industrial or labor action;
